Psychiatry is often misunderstood, regularly conflated with psychology. However, while psychology focuses on habits and mental procedures, psychiatry constitutes a medical field that emphasizes the biological and physiological aspects of mental health. Psychiatrists are medical doctors focusing on mental health, efficient in prescribing medication and using various healing methods.
2. Short History of Psychiatry
Psychiatry has a varied and complex history, evolving from ancient practices to a sophisticated branch of medication:
EraDescriptionAncient TimesEarly views of mental health problem were frequently linked to spiritual or supernatural phenomena.Middle AgesThe "asylums" emerged, often working as jails for those considered outrageous rather than as treatment centers.18th-- 19th CenturyThe humanitarian movement started, leading to more compassionate care, with figures like Philippe Pinel promoting for ethical treatment.20th CenturyPsychiatry experienced quick development with the introduction of psychoanalysis by Sigmund Freud, reliable drugs, and modern restorative methods.21st CenturyFocus on neuroscience has actually intensified, as has the acknowledgment of the socio-cultural influences on mental health.3. Common Psychiatric Disorders
Psychiatrists encounter a large selection of mental health conditions. Here are some of the most common:
DisorderDescriptionSignificant Depressive DisorderAn incapacitating condition characterized by persistent sadness and loss of interest.Generalized Anxiety DisorderA stress and anxiety condition marked by extreme concern throughout different circumstances.Bipolar DisorderA mood disorder typified by extreme state of mind swings, from mania to anxiety.SchizophreniaA chronic disorder that affects a person's thinking, feeling, and habits.Post-Traumatic Stress Disorder (PTSD)Anxiety resulting from experiencing or seeing a distressing occasion.5. Treatment Modalities
Different treatment options are available in psychiatry, customized to an individual's requirements:
A. Psychotherapy TechniquesCogn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T): Focuses on altering negative idea patterns.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T): Combines cognitive-behavioral methods with mindfulness strategies.Psychoanalysis: An extensive exploration of unconscious ideas and youth experiences.B. PharmacotherapyAntidepressants: Commonly recommended for anxiety and anxiety disorders.Antipsychotics: Effective in handling symptoms of schizophrenia and state of mind conditions.Mood Stabilizers: Used primarily for bipolar condition.C. Alternative ApproachesMindfulness and Meditation: Techniques that minimize tension and boost self-awareness.Animal-Assisted Therapy: The usage of skilled animals to promote emotional well-being.Exercise and Lifestyle Changes: Physical activity and healthy way of life adjustments have proven beneficial for mental health.6. Challenges in Psychiatry
In spite of considerable improvements, psychiatry faces substantial difficulties:
Stigmatization: Negative perceptions surrounding mental health can deter people from looking for assistance.Access to Care: Limited resources, particularly in backwoods, hinder treatment schedule.Mental Health Disparities: Socioeconomic aspects can intensify mental health concerns and access to care.7.
